簡體   English   中英

我如何將+1全局添加到mysql中的表?

[英]How would I globally add +1 to a table in mysql?

sql服務器出現問題,我的投票系統讓人們退縮了1天。 我要彌補他們的損失,並給他們增加1分以彌補損失。

我將如何去做? 我在想這個,但我認為它不會起作用。

SELECT votepoints FROM vsystem where votepoints=votepoints+1

UPDATE vsystem SET投票點=投票點+1

不。您的意思就像是搜索等於結果加1的搜索。那不是真的。

您可以更新表:

update vsystem set votepoints = votepoints + 1

...或獲得結果+ 1(無需修改表格):

select (votepoints + 1) as voteplus from vsystem

如果要一次性修復,請執行以下操作:

UPDATE vsystem
SET votepoints = votepoints + 1

這將在vsystem表中的每一行的votepoints列中添加1。

UPDATE vsystem SET投票點=投票點+1;

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M